In this commercial, created with the theme “Too powerful!”, Mana Ashida and Eiko Koike show off their kung fu as they try to break a board held by Tetsuro Degawa.
Ashida goes for a punch, while Koike aims a flying kick, and they end up launching not just the board but Degawa himself.
The “too powerful” here refers to how strong Y!mobile’s family discount is.
Details of the discount appear at the end of the commercial, so be sure to check it out.
By the way, the familiar background music is the theme song from the film Enter the Dragon.

In a Y!mobile commercial, they promote that domestic calls are free for people aged 60 and over.
The ad is a live-action adaptation of Fujio Akatsuka’s gag manga “Genius Bakabon,” with Tetsurō Degawa as Papa, Eiko Koike as Mama, and Mana Ashida as Bakabon.
Because the calls are free, Degawa keeps phoning to say “I love you, no da,” and while Koike cautions him not to call so often, her expression shows she’s actually pleased.
